The Japanese garbage collectors' union demanded that the film be banned from video shelves as it disparaged trash collectors, portraying them in a poor light.
Charlie Sheen pulled a prank on Emilio Estevez by saying that he had punched a paparazzo in a restaurant on the night before filming. Sheen took it further by having an on-set police officer who was working security arrest him for assault while he was filming a scene. Estevez was stunned until Sheen returned laughing.
Potterdam's hit men's license plate in fact says "HIT MEN".
James' (Emilio Estevez's) locker contains a sticker for "The Circle Jerks", who starred with him in Repo Man (1984).
